Abstract

Methods, systems and processes can enable custom message formats in trading. One of the methods includes storing a plurality of different record formats. The method includes receiving a trade record, the trade record identifying a record format of the plurality of different message formats. The method includes identifying potential matching trade records to the trade record. The method includes comparing the trade record to at least one of the potential matches based on the message format. The method also includes generating a matching record based on determining that one of the potential matching trade records matches the message

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A system comprising:
 a processor;   a non-transitory memory, the memory including computer instructions that, when executed, causes the processor to perform operations comprising:   storing a plurality of different record formats;   receiving a trade record, the trade record identifying a record format of the plurality of different message formats;   identifying potential matching trade records to the trade record;   comparing the trade record to at least one of the potential matches based on the message format; and   generating a matching record based on determining that one of the potential matching trade records matches the message.   
     
     
         2 . The system of  claim 1 , wherein the operations further comprise:
 storing at least one trade record in trade record data store.   
     
     
         3 . The system of  claim 1 , wherein the record format identifies matching fields in the trade record, and comparing the trade record includes comparting matching fields in the trade record to at least some matching fields in the at least one of the potential matches. 
     
     
         4 . The system of  claim 1 , further comprising storing the trade record in a record datastore based on determining that none of the potential matching records matches the message. 
     
     
         5 . The system of  claim 1 , wherein the operations further comprise establishing a new record format between at least two users, the record format identifying fields. 
     
     
         6 . The system of  claim 1 , wherein the message format is determined by users of the system. 
     
     
         7 . A computer-implemented method comprising:
 storing a plurality of different record formats;   receiving a trade record, the trade record identifying a record format of the plurality of different message formats;   identifying potential matching trade records to the trade record;   comparing the trade record to at least one of the potential matches based on the message format; and   generating a matching record based on determining that one of the potential matching trade records matches the message.
